Section 5(2) in The Bureau Of Indian Standards (Certification) Regulations, 1988

(2)When a Standard Mark has been specified in respect of an article or process, no person other than the licensee in possession of a valid [licence or registration] shall make any public claim, through any advertisement, sales promotion leaflets, price-lists or the like, that his product conforms to the relevant Indian Standard or carries the Standard Mark.Explanation.-For the purpose of this sub-regulation, a claim as to conformity of one's product to an Indian Standard in reply to a specific query or in a tender addressed to any individual customer shall not be deemed to be a public claim.
